Category Service / Technician Type FT Non-Union (FTN) Overview Milton Rents is hiring Heavy Equipment Road/Field Mechanic to support a modern, well-maintained fleet of construction rental equipment. This role is ideal for technicians with experience in diesel engines, hydraulics, electrical systems, preventive maintenance, and equipment repair. Technicians work in a professional, team-oriented environment and collaborate daily with yard personnel, drivers, counter staff, and branch managers. You'll service late-model equipment and play a key role in keeping equipment running safely and efficiently. Supportive team culture focused on safety, quality, and communication Responsibilities Heavy Equipment Repair Perform preventive maintenance, inspections, and mechanical repairs on rental construction equipment
Travel to job sites for on-site maintenance, service and repairs
Deliver exceptional customer service through positive, solutionfocused interactions.
Diagnose and troubleshoot diesel engines, hydraulic systems, and electrical systems
Use diagnostic software, gauges, and specialized tools to identify equipment issues
Test-run equipment to verify repairs and ensure operational safety
Train and mentor technicians Documentation & Teamwork Complete work orders, service reports, and maintenance records accurately and on time
Support shop and customer workflow and assist other technicians as needed Qualifications Hands-on experience as a diesel/heavy equipment mechanic, rental, construction or fleet mechanic.
High school diploma, trade school certificate or equivalent experience.
Strong diagnostic skills in mechanical, hydraulic, and electrical systems
Valid driver's license and ability to operate vehicles safely
Personal set of professional-grade mechanic's tools
